  • the present invention relates to the treatment of hides for the production of shoes, handbags, belts and the like.
  • the invention relates to a process for the treatment of hides comprising their vegetable tanning, and more precisely for the so-called stuffing stage; the invention also relates to compositions of fatty substances that can be used for the said stuffing stage.

  • the problem at the root of the present invention is that of making available a process for the treatment of hides comprising vegetable tanning thereof, which process makes it possible to obtain a hide that has characteristics of softness to the touch superior to those obtained hitherto with known processes.
  • the aforementioned mixture of fatty substances preferably contains, as percentages by weight relative to the total weight of the mixture, 55-65% of tallow, 12-17% of marine animal oil and 22-27% of oxidized marine animal oil.
  • the aforementioned compression is preferably carried out at a pressure of 380-420 atmospheres, using a plate press.
  • drum used in the treatment described above it is preferable for the drum used in the treatment described above to be rotated at a speed of 16-18 rev/min.
  • Drum treatment of the hides with the mixture of fatty substances generally takes from 1.5 to 4 hours.
  • the aforementioned mixture of fatty substances prefferably contain from 0.3 to 1.0% of a fungicide.
  • the hide obtained by the process according to the invention can then be sent to the usual stages of smoothing and drying and to optional stages of finishing, polishing, stamping, etc., before being used for the manufacture of leather goods, shoe uppers, etc.
  • the hide produced using the process of the invention is characterized, relative to all hides produced hitherto using known processes of the art, in that it has a very special "handle" that is immediately recognizable by any person skilled in the art. That is, the hide is extremely and pleasantly soft to the touch, though without displaying excessive yielding, and on the contrary exhibiting excellent properties of resistance to mechanical deformation.
  • the special handle of the hide obtained with the process according to the invention is due both to the particular way in which the hide is prepared during the stuffing stage and to the specific composition of fatty substances used for that stage.
  • the stage of compression to which the hide is subjected has the purpose of adjusting its moisture content to an ideal value for penetration of the fatty substances during the subsequent stage of stuffing.
  • An excessively high moisture content would not permit sufficient and uniform penetration of the fatty substances, producing a hide with a handle that is too "greasy” and therefore too yielding.
  • composition of the mixture of fatty substances used for the stuffing stage is critical for achieving an optimum result in terms of handle of the final hide.
  • An excessive deviation from the ranges stated for the various components can result in hides that are too dry or conversely too soft and characterized by a greasy handle.

  • the hides prepared according to the above examples all possessed handle characterized by extreme softness yet accompanied by characteristics of excellent elasticity and resistance to mechanical deformation.
  • composition of fatty substances used in the process according to the invention offers the advantage that it i ⁇ absolutely stable and can be stored perfectly at room temperature for long periods of time. It is not therefore necessary for the composition to be prepared at the very moment of application of the process according to the invention, on the contrary it can be prepared in great quantities, to meet the needs of production for several weeks.

Ce procédé de traitement des peaux par tannage végétal consiste à soumettre des peaux parées et teintes à une compression d'une pression d'au moins 380 atmosphères pendant environ 4 à 5 heures, à les mettre en suif dans un tanneau à témpérature ambiante avec 15 à 20 % en poids d'un mélange de substances grasses à base de graisses et huiles animales comprenant 1,2 à 2,5 % en poids d'une huile de poisson sulfonée, puis à poursuivre ce traitement jusqu'à ce que le température des peaux atteigne 24 à 36 °C. On décrit aussi une composition de mise en suif des peaux parées et teintes. Les peaux obtenues par le procédé et la composition décrits se caractérisent par une grande douceur au toucher accompagnée d'une excellent résistance aux contraintes et déformations mécaniques.
